ANXA2, DBN1, ZNF385D, and IL6ST: Endothelial cell biomarkers linking atherosclerosis progression to immune microenvironment dysregulation

Key Points

  • The research aims to identify endothelial cell biomarkers that connect atherosclerosis progression with immune microenvironment changes.
  • Identified biomarkers associated with endothelial cells in the context of atherosclerosis.
  • Analyzed the relationship between these biomarkers and immune dysregulation.
  • Identified key biomarkers including ANXA2, DBN1, ZNF385D, and IL6ST.
  • Demonstrated a link between these biomarkers and atherosclerosis progression.
  • Provided insights for potential targeted therapies for atherosclerosis.
